Biography
Milton Kam is a Surinamese cinematographer. He moved to New York to study filmmaking at the City College of New York (CUNY). He is a frequent collaborator of British director Simon Rumley, American director Rick Lopez, and Israeli-American filmmaker Ela Thier.
